Amanda Bible Williams and Raechel Myers, co-founders of She Reads Truth, explore the meaning of Advent and its transformative power in our lives. They emphasize the importance of community connection, engaging in daily Bible readings, and fostering family traditions that deepen faith. With personal stories of family meals and musical memories, they highlight how these experiences enhance the celebration of Christmas. Their heartfelt discussion inspires listeners to reflect on the true meaning of the season beyond commercialism.
